What is Claude AI and How Does It Work for Marketers?
Claude AI is an advanced AI chatbot and language model developed by Anthropic. Designed for safe, accurate, and nuanced conversations, Claude stands out for its ability to generate high-quality text, summarize research, draft emails, outline strategies, and more. For marketers, Claude is a versatile assistant—taking on research, content planning, ideation, and even campaign optimization.
- Provides fast content creation across blogs, emails, ads, and social posts.
- Acts as a powerful brainstorming partner.
- Boosts SEO research and clustering for better rankings.
- Helps with audience analysis and personalization.
- Summarizes dense marketing reports or competitor data.

Top Use Cases: How Marketers Are Winning with Claude AI
1. Rapid Content Generation (Articles, Ads, Social)
Claude makes content creation quick and tailored:
- Write SEO-optimized blog posts
- Draft compelling ad copy or landing pages
- Generate creative ideas for social media campaigns
- Personalize emails or outreach templates
2. SEO Keyword Clustering & Research
Save hours on keyword analysis:
- Paste keyword lists for clustering and intent analysis
- Get suggestions for long-tail, low competition keywords
- Outline pillar and cluster content strategies

3. Data Summarization & Trend Monitoring
Claude can read and summarize long marketing reports, competitor analysis, or consumer trend data. Get a concise briefing on what matters most—no more information overload.
4. Creative Brainstorming & Campaign Ideation
Need a burst of inspiration? Claude provides headline ideas, creative angles, or campaign themes. It’s like having a strategic partner always ready for your next big pitch.
5. Audience Persona Expansion
Expand or refine customer personas based on new inputs. Claude can “interview” a persona, suggest messaging tweaks, or uncover hidden audience needs.

Best Practices for Marketers Using Claude AI (2024 Edition)
- Always Guide with Clear Prompts: Specificity = Better Results
- Edit and Fact-Check Outputs: Claude is powerful but not perfect; human editing is crucial for quality & compliance.
- Stay Updated: New features roll out regularly—check release notes and test them.
- Blend with Human Creativity: Use Claude for drafts—add your strategic insight for maximum impact.
- Monitor KPIs: Track campaign performance pre/post-Claude. Use learnings to optimize future prompts and strategies.
Potential Pitfalls & Mistakes Marketers Should Avoid
- Blindly trusting AI outputs: Always review for factual accuracy and brand-safety.
- Ignoring Data Privacy Concerns: Don’t feed Claude sensitive or regulated information—review Anthropic’s privacy policy first.
- Underestimating the Need for Human Oversight: Claude is a co-pilot, not an autopilot.
- Overusing Generic Prompts: Be as precise as possible for unique, brand-fit content.

FAQs: Claude AI for Marketers
How does Claude AI compare to ChatGPT for marketing content?
Claude is preferred for safe, context-aware text. It excels at summarizing reports or writing in a natural tone. ChatGPT is more playful and supports a broader plugin ecosystem.
Is Claude AI safe for handling client or sensitive data?
Claude is built with privacy-first engineering, but do not upload confidential client data. Always review your company’s compliance and Anthropic’s data policies.
Can Claude integrate with my marketing automation or CRM tools?
Yes, Claude offers API access for custom integrations. Check compatibility with your automation provider or CRM—review official API docs.
